Plagne Bellecôte is a ski resort in Belle-Plagne, Rhone-Alpes, FR. It has 9 km of pistes, 8 lifts, elevation up to 1931 m. Slopes break down into 9 km beginner, 0 km intermediate, 0 km advanced. Connected via lifts to La Plagne, Montchavin, Belle Plagne for a combined 388 km ski area.
